The AO3423 uses advanced trench technology to provide
excellent R
DS(ON)
, low gate charge and operation with gate
voltages as low as 2.5V. This device is suitable for use as
a load switch applications.

A. The value of RθJA is measured with the device mounted on 1in2FR-4 board with 2oz. Copper, in a still air environment with TA=25°C. The
value in any given application depends on the user's specific board design.
B. The power dissipation PDis based on TJ(MAX)=150°C, using 10s junction-to-ambient thermal resistance.
C. Repetitive rating, pulse width limited by junction temperature TJ(MAX)=150°C. Ratings are based on low frequency and duty cycles to keep
initialTJ=25°C.
D. The RθJA is the sum of the thermal impedance from junction to lead RθJL and lead to am bient.
E. The static characteristics in Figures 1 to 6 are obtained using <300µs pulses, duty cycle 0.5% max.
F. These curves are based on the junction-to-ambient thermal impedance which is measured with the device mounted on 1in2FR-4 board with
2oz. Copper, assuming a maximum junction temperature of TJ(MAX)=150°C. The SOA curve provides a single pulse rating.
